Ingredients

3 medium onions , chopped
2 tablespoons butter or 2 tablespoons margarine
1 bunch fresh cilantro ( entire sprigs , not chopped )
1 tablespoon flour
1 tablespoon red wine vinegar
1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
2 eggs , beaten
2 tablespoons fresh dill , minced
2 tablespoons fresh parsley leaves , chopped
1 -2 teaspoon lemon juice
6 cups hot water
1/4 cup hot chicken stock or 1/4 cup vegetable stock
salt and pepper
Chikhirtma is a flavorful soup that is easy to make and perfect for a light meal. It is a traditional Georgian soup made with onions, fresh cilantro, and eggs, and it is often served as a hangover cure. The soup has a light, fresh taste and a unique flavor, thanks to the combination of cilantro and onion. Instructions

1.In a large pot, melt the butter or margarine over medium heat.
2.Add chopped onions and cook until they are translucent and soft, stirring occasionally.
3.Add the flour and mix well.
4.Add hot chicken or vegetable stock, water, and cinnamon.
5.Bring the soup to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for about 5 minutes.
6.Add a bunch of fresh cilantro sprigs and simmer for another few minutes until they wilt.
7.Remove the pot from heat and remove the cilantro sprigs.
8.Allow the soup to cool slightly, then add beaten eggs, stirring continuously to prevent the eggs from curdling.
9.Add fresh dill, parsley, lemon juice, salt, and pepper.
10.Return the pot to heat and gently heat the soup, stirring occasionally, until it is hot and steamy. Do not boil.
11.Serve hot.
